Tbf Paul most teams will lose to Man City and Arsenal away heavily. We have, at least, played 3 of the top 7 teams away as well as recent champions (Leicester).



Our one away goal (well, we might have more if VAR didn't happen) got us a point at Everton and could have been 3 if we'd held onto the lead. Likewise the 3-2 at home vs Fulham and Bournemouth were disappointing because we were ahead in both games but we have been better at that recently.



There's plenty of room for improvement but we had to settle 22 new players in the summer and with another about to be registered and who knows what we will bring in during the window, hopefully not too many as we really only need a striker who can hold it up better than the ones we have. But not everyone is going to be able to afford a Haaland or an Alvarez or a Rashford in the window so we're not going to be getting an established PL player there either. If we can get a mobile CB that would be nice too but actually I think Boly alongside one of the 3 from last season would probably be OK.



As for last night it was important we held on and didn't do anything silly at the back. Then someone decided not to mark Rashford (don't get zonal marking at all) and gave him a free sandwich, er I mean shot. He wasn't going to miss that. I don't think the 2nd was a keeping error. He was wrong footed by it bouncing and going through Boly's legs and was largely unsighted until late on yet managed to get a hand on it, unfortunately that wasn't enough to tip it wide, which perhaps made it look worse than if he'd not got to it at all. Then we have Dennis being silly as per usual and giving the ball away in a dangerous area and they got a 3rd. But largely we didn't do too badly and it could have easily been another 5 or 6 but I don't think many would have expected us to get anything at all really.


At worst we go down and keep the squad for promotion again next season.
